Mortgage Asset Services 4+ · Macquarie Bank Limited · iPhone Screenshots · Additional Screenshots · Description · What's New · App Privacy.Western Asset Mortgage Capital Corporation is a real estate investment trust that invests in, acquires and manages a diverse portfolio of assets consisting of Residential Whole Loans, Non-Agency ...What is an Asset-Based Mortgage? As the name suggests, asset-based mortgages use your assets to determine if you qualify for a home loan. So, instead of providing traditional income documentation, like pay stubs, W2s tax returns, the lender classifies assets as income to compute the loan amount you’re eligible for.Asset Qualifier Loan - No Employment Required. Toxic asset. A toxic asset is a financial asset that has fallen in value significantly and for which there is no longer a functioning market. Such assets cannot be sold at a price satisfactory to the holder.
